St John Ambulance - Sittingbourne Cadet Unit

A group for young people aged 10 to 17years old. An opportunity to meet new people, learn new skills and undertake leadership training. Support your local community and raise awareness of basis first aid skills and knowledge.

Marden Library group activity - Talk Time

Thursday 10am to 11am
Marden Dementia Friendly Community and Marden Library are working in partnership to bring local people a drop-in Talk Time group that will support those living with dementia and their families, friends, carers, and neighbours.
